Abstract

Fingerprint is immutable and unchangeable. Thus, if it is disclosed, owner of fingerprint cannot use his fingerprint any longer. Fuzzy vault is a cryptographic framework that makes secure template storage to bind the template with a uniformly random key. In order to keep fuzzy vault secure, various schemes are studied using special data like password. K.Nandakumar proposed a scheme for hardening a fingerprint minutiae-based fuzzy vault using password. However, that scheme has vulnerabilities against several attacks. In this paper, we analyze vulnerabilities of K.Nandakumar’s scheme and propose a new scheme which is secure against various attacks to fuzzy vaults.
